Join a 'Researchers in Pursuit' scheme - the Pan-Commonwealth Researchers Bootcamp

Calling all young (and not-so-young) researchers from Commonwealth countries! Get involved in an ambitious research challenge by applying for the #OPENUPYOURTHINKING - Pan-Commonwealth Researchers Bootcamp challenge by Friday 05 June 2020. Taking place from 08-30 June 2020.
The research will look at macro, meso and micro-level implications of COVID-19 in Commonwealth countries. We are looking for young (and not-so-young researchers) that want to do something about the threat of COVID-19 to education. We need 10-15 researchers for each thematic area, under the age of 35. This project will take place online, and be overseen by experienced researchers of all ages. Airtime or data stipend will be provided. There are fifteen thematic areas (see the list below). 

Please note that applications are open only to residents of Commonwealth Member States (see list below) and a commensurate weighting will be applied across shortlisted applications.
